When you have your cooking recipes in hand and your cupboard stock is low, check this list for substitute ingredients in a pinch.
  • Allspice (1 teaspoon) = 1/2 teaspoon cinnamon, 1/2 teaspoon ground cloves;


  • Beer = Strong chicken broth, beef broth or mushroom broth;


  • Brown sugar (1 cup) = 1 cup granulated sugar plus 1 tablespoon molasses or dark corn syrup;


  • Buttermilk (1 cup for baking) = Mix 1 tablespoon white vinegar or lemon juice with 1 cup milk, let stand 5 minutes;

  • Cake flour (1 cup) = 7/8 cup all-purpose flour plus 2 tablespoons cornstarch;


  • Chili powder (1 tablespoon) = 2 teaspoons cumin, 1 teaspoon cayenne, 1 teaspoon oregano, 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der;


  • Cornstarch (1 tablespoon) = 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our;


  • Cream (1 cup, half-and-half) = 1 1/2 tablespoons butter plus enough whole milk to equal 1 cup, or 1/2 cup light cream plus 1/2 cup whole milk;


  • Cream of tartar (1/2 teaspoon) = 1 1/2 teaspoons lemon juice or vinegar;


  • Crame fraiche (1 cup) = 1/2 cup sour cream plus 1/2 cup heavy cream;


  • Oil = Applesauce (for baking purposes);


  • Red wine = Apple cider, beef broth or tomato juice


  • Sugar (granulated, 1 cup) = 2 cups powdered sugar, or 3/4 cup honey (with liquid in recipe reduced by 1/4 cup);


  • Vinegar = Lemon juice;


  • White wine = White grape juice, apple juice, apple cider, chicken broth;


  • Yogurt = Sour cream, buttermilk or cottage cheese blended smooth;
  • Sources: The Food Lover’s Companion by Sharon Tyler Herbst (BarronĂ¢’s, 1995) and www.recipetips.com

Content of Cans

  • No. 300 = 1 3/4 cups
  • No. 1 flat = 1 cup
  • No. 1 tall = 2 cups
  • No. 303 = 2 cups
  • No. 2 = 2 1/2 cups
  • No. 2 1/2 = 3 1/2 cups
  • No. 19 = 12 to 13 cups

KITCHEN MEASURES

  • 3 tsp = 1 tbsp.


  • 2 tbsp. = 1 fluid ounce


  • 4 tbsp. = 1/4 cup


  • 16 tbsp. = 1 cup


  • 1 cup = 8 oz.


  • 2 cups = 1 pint


  • 2 pints = 1 quart


  • 4 quarts = 1 gallon


  • 8 quarts = 1 peck


  • 4 pecks = 1 bushel


  • 16 ounces = 1 pound


  • 2 cups liquid = 1 pound


  • 4 cups flour = 1 pound


  • 2 cups granulated sugar = 1 pound


  • 2 2/3 cups brown sugar = 1 pound


  • 3 1/2 cups powdered sugar = 1 pound


  • 2 cups butter = 1 pound


  • 2 cups solid meat = 1 pound
